Downtempo Ambience Trip Hop Chillout etc...
Any recommendations? Of course the usual Portishead, Morcheeba, Zero 7, Sigur Ross, Sia, etc... looking for others.
|
Nightmares on Wax
|
my favorite genre.
Hooverphonic Flunk Air Conjure One Delerium (some of it) Massive Attack (you didn't list it) Sade Olive Supreme Beings of Leisure Telepopmusik Baxter Dot Allison Hertz Lunascape Endorphin Terranova Daughter Darling Madita Hybrid Beauty's Confusion Laika Soulstice Martina Topley Bird Etro Anime Xploding Plastix Alphawezen Airlock Canidas Crustation Soma Sonic Backini Bowery Electric Leftfield Frou Frou Jem Halou Smoke City Not all of these groups are all trip-hop, but all of them have at least a few trip-hop songs. Most are exclusively trip-hop. |
